Methods for Finding Celebrity Financial Estimates
Reliable information on this topic is rarely found in a single, definitive source. Instead, it is compiled through a combination of investigative reporting and public record analysis. The following methods represent the primary avenues through which the public accesses these financial assessments.
Public Records and Legal Filings
For high-profile individuals, financial information becomes public during legal proceedings such as divorces or bankruptcy filings. These court documents provide a verifiable, though often dated, snapshot of assets and liabilities. Additionally, property records and business registrations can offer clues about investment portfolios and real estate holdings that contribute to a celebrity's overall wealth.
Forbes and Industry Trackers
Publications like Forbes have long been recognized as authorities in this space, utilizing a team of researchers to analyze income streams. They consider factors such as salary, endorsements, music royalties, and business ventures to arrive at annual earnings and estimated net worth. These reports provide a standardized methodology that allows for comparison across different industries and regions.

Ethical Considerations and Accuracy
It is crucial to approach these figures with a critical eye, recognizing the inherent limitations of the data. The line between verified fact and informed speculation is often blurred. Many numbers are projections based on market trends, brand deals, and past performance, rather than audited account statements.
Privacy is another significant ethical concern. While public figures operate in a spotlight, their financial details exist on a spectrum. Responsible consumers of this information should consider the human element behind the statistics and the potential for misinformation to spread rapidly online. The goal should be understanding, not intrusion.
The Impact of Digital Monetization
In the modern landscape, the traditional metrics for calculating wealth are evolving rapidly. The rise of social media has introduced new variables that are difficult to quantify but undeniably valuable. A celebrity's influence on plat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ube generates income through direct sponsorships and affiliate marketing.
These digital ventures often operate outside the traditional structures of Hollywood or the music industry, making them harder to track. Consequently, the net worth calculated today might not reflect the true economic power wielded by an individual in the current digital economy.
